Mark Henry is all dressed up for his date with D-Lo there for moral support. He wants D-Lo to accompany him on the date. Henry has purchased a blazer for D-Lo to dress him up and also got him a new pair of sunglasses. He wraps it up with a driver's hat and suddenly D-Lo realizes what is happening and is not happy about it. In the next segment, Chyna shows up at the hotel and just wants to get this over with. Then Henry gives Chyna flowers but left the price tag ($1.99) on. They end up in the restaurant and Chyna seems annoyed while Henry tries to be romantic. She warms up to him a little when they get on the dance floor and dance to "Brick House", but is still pretty guarded. Mark walks away for a second when three guys come up and start putting the moves on Chyna and their attention is clearly unwanted. One of the guys calls her a bitch and she punches him and Henry takes out the other two guys. This actually sort of worked in the end, even if there were too many segments.
